What Development System to make it

appMobi◦ Programming Language: HTML5 (JavaScript, CSS3, HTML5)◦ Cross-platform deployment: iOS, Android, HTML5 Web Apps, HTML5 Hybrid Apps◦ Debugger and Emulator◦ FREE

FeedHenry◦ Programming Language: HTML, CSS, JavaScript◦ Cross-platform deployment: Apple iPhone & iPad, Android, Windows Phone 7, Blackberry,

Nokia WRT.◦ Debugger and Emulator◦ FREE

MoSync◦ Programming Language: C, C++, Lua, HTML5, CSS, JavaScript◦ Cross-platform deployment: Android, Java ME, Moblin, iOS (iPhone), Smartphone 2003,

Symbian, Windows Mobile (Pocket PC), Blackberry (experimental)◦ Debugger and Emulator◦ FREE

Tools you'll need for Testing

Monkey Talk: This is a free Mobile Application Testing tool for iOS, Android, HTML 5, and Flex applications

eggPlant: A GUI based automated test tool for mobile application across all operating systems and devices.

Robotium: This is an automation tool for Android Mobile Application

Sikuli: This is a visual technology to automate and test graphical user interfaces (GUI) using images.

The Lazy User Model

Lazy User Model of Solution Selection (LUM) is a model in information systems that tries to explain how an individual selects a solution to fulfill a need from a set of possible solution alternatives...

The model draws from earlier works on how least effort affects human behavior in information seeking and in scaling of language.
